Application Fees

ItemNigerian StudentsInternational Students
ApplicationN20,000N20,000
Admission Processing FeeN20,000N20,000
Admission Acceptance FeeN20,000N20,000

Registration Fees

ProgrammeJigawa State IndigeneOther Nigerian StudentsInternational Students
M.A. in Arabic, English, Islamic Studies, M.Ed. Curriculum, Educational PsychN120,000N150,000USD 500
M.Sc. in Biology, Chemistry, Computer Science, Mathematics, PhysicsN160,000N200,000USD 600
Ph.D. in Arabic, English, Islamic Studies, Curriculum Studies, Psych.N160,000N200,000USD 750
Ph.D. in Biology, Chemistry, Computer Science, Mathematics, PhysicsN200,000N250,000USD 1000
PGD in Arabic, Islamic Studies, English, EducationN96,000N120,000USD 400
PGD in Biology, Chemistry, Computer Science, Mathematics, PhysicsN112,000N140,000USD 450

Other Charges

ItemNigerian StudentsInternational Students
Medical FeeN5,000N5,000
ID Card FeeN5,000N5,000
Change of Programme of StudyN20,000N20,000
Addition/Dropping of CoursesN5,000N5,000
Deferment Fee (Semester)N10,000N10,000
Deferment Fee (Session)N20,000N20,000
Carry Over Fee (Per Course)N10,000N10,000
Late RegistrationN10,000N10,000
PG Supervision (PGD)N15,000N15,000
PG Supervision (Master)N20,000N20,000
PG Supervision (Ph.D)N25,000N25,000
Thesis Submission (Masters)N40,000N40,000
Thesis Submission (Ph.D)N70,000N70,000
Progress ReportN5,000N5,000
Statement of ResultN10,000N10,000
ICT ChargesN20,000N20,000
Library Service ChargesN10,000N10,000

How to Pay Sule Lamido University Postgraduate School Fees 2024/2025

If you are a postgraduate student of Sule Lamido University, follow the steps below to complete your school fees payment successfully:-

  1. Go to the university’s official website at  www.slu.edu.ng.
  2. Click on the “Student Portal” link on the homepage. Log in using your username and password to access your dashboard.
  3. Once logged in, locate the “School Fees Payment” section. Generate your payment invoice, which will include a Remita Retrieval Reference (RRR) number.
  4. Using the RRR number, pay your fees through the Remita platform. You can do this online using a debit card or by visiting any commercial bank to make the payment over the counter.
  5. After payment, go back to the student portal to verify the transaction and print your official payment receipt.
  6. Present the printed receipt to the SLU Bursary Department for confirmation. This ensures your payment is recorded and recognized by the school.
  7. Make several photocopies of your payment receipt. It’s advisable to keep extra copies for future reference or official use.
